Evgeny Vladimirovich Kuznetsov ( Russian: Евгений Владимирович Кузнецов; born 12 April 1990) is a Russian diver. At the diving portion of the 2011 World Aquatics Championships he won a bronze in the 3 m springboard, and was the part of the pair who won the silver medal in the 3 m synchronised springboard. [1]

Kuznetsov won a silver medal for his country at the 2012 Summer Olympics, in the 3 m synchronised springboard with Ilya Zakharov. [2] At the 2016 Summer Olympics, Kuznetsov again competed in both the 3 m springboard and the 3 m synchronised springboard diving. [2] At the 2017 World Aquatics Championships in Budapest, Hungary, the Russian won his first gold medal in 3 m synchronized springboard, with his partner Ilya Zakharov.[ citation needed]
